Transaction 2fc642ca00cca174080286bab5ee70c7ba1a7ac62b595a45a7d1aaecd4d0d76d

34 Input
2 Outputs
  • 2fc642ca00cca174080286bab5ee70c7ba1a7ac62b595a45a7d1aaecd4d0d76d:0
  • value  547905
    address  bc1qfxr2gcrvlkqr9ld4sz04lj5nn9vp3vga3pqt8zqvsxx6ffay260sc4uau6
  • 2fc642ca00cca174080286bab5ee70c7ba1a7ac62b595a45a7d1aaecd4d0d76d:1
  • value  33768000
    address  3AF1aUYXs5tZe5MZCAT5r3hK2ZwatL8vLK